Game Wave repair help.

Postby fuzzyoddball » Sun Mar 21, 2021 8:29 pm

I was using my game wave today to test some DVD's and next moment I try using it the screen is blank.
I reflowed the Powerboard PCB worried there was a break or something like a cold break happened seeing as there was no visible issues. Still no luck.
I probed out the power pins and found a possible issue of under voltage;

PCB labeled; gnd, 3.3, 3.3, gnd, stby, on, -12v, + 12v , agnd, 5va

What my multi meter shows; gnd, 3.18, 3.18, gnd, -9.88, 10.40, sby, on, gnd, 5

I am unsure if I am on the right track for this system. Or if this is a symptom of some other problem.
Any suggestions?

PS. If you do or do not know what a Game Wave is... It is a short lived Canadian DVD based set top console. only having aprox 13 games made for it and 70,000 consoles produced. It was a short lived system that only sold for 3 years as a party game system and not as a system for indepth gaming. Officially...

I find it good for later released IDVD or Dvd Games.
Due to the system being Region free and having multiple controllers it is great for DVD board games, as well as import titles that use IDVD, DVD game, or other DVD player interactions.
Example DVD titles; Dracula Unleashed DVD FMV, Dragonia Interactive novel, dragon lair FMV, SceneIt!, Mad dog McCree, Wallace & Gromit curse of the wear rabbit interactive DVD, Blankity Blank, Tomb Raider; The action Adventure.
Sadly I was unable to try if it is able to play Nuon Game's... I doubt it due to this does not use the Nuon System... Nor can it read CD's... I do not think it can support VCD's
